Tent Fumigation in Woodbridge, VA
Tent fumigation services involve the controlled application of gases to eliminate pests, such as termites, bed bugs, or other invasive insects, from residential properties. This process is typically used for larger projects, including entire homes or structures with severe infestations, where surface treatments are insufficient. Homeowners often request tent fumigation when facing persistent pest issues that require thorough eradication, especially in cases where infested furniture, woodwork, or structural elements need comprehensive treatment.
Before requesting tent fumigation, property owners usually seek to understand the scope of the service, including preparation requirements, duration, and safety considerations. It is important to know whether the entire property needs to be vacated during treatment and what steps are necessary beforehand to ensure effective results. Clarifying these details helps homeowners plan accordingly and ensures a smooth process for pest elimination.

Tent Fumigation Questions
What types of pests can be controlled with tent fumigation? Tent fumigation is effective against a wide range of pests, including termites, bed bugs, and certain stored product insects.
Is tent fumigation safe for my property? When performed by professionals, tent fumigation is a controlled process that minimizes risks to the property and occupants.
How should I prepare my property for tent fumigation? Preparation typically involves removing food, personal items, and covering or protecting sensitive belongings as advised.
What areas of a property can be treated with tent fumigation? The process can be applied to entire structures such as homes, warehouses, or commercial buildings requiring pest control.
